What Key Features Make a Great Men’s Casual Rain Boot?

The key features that make a great men’s casual rain boot include comfort, waterproofing, style, traction, and ease of maintenance.

  • Comfort: A great rain boot should provide ample comfort for all-day wear. This can include cushioned insoles, breathable linings, and ergonomic designs that support the feet during movement.
  • Waterproofing: The best men’s casual rain boots are made from materials that are fully waterproof, such as rubber or treated leather. This ensures that your feet stay dry, even in the heaviest rain, while also preventing moisture from seeping in through seams or materials.
  • Style: Casual rain boots come in various styles that can complement different outfits, from classic designs to more modern aesthetics. A versatile look allows them to be worn in both casual and semi-formal settings, making them a fashionable choice for rainy days.
  • Traction: A good rain boot should have a slip-resistant sole designed to provide grip on wet surfaces. This feature is crucial for preventing slips and falls, especially on slick pavements or muddy terrain.
  • Ease of Maintenance: The best rain boots are easy to clean and maintain, often requiring just a quick wipe down after use. Materials that resist stains and do not absorb water help ensure that the boots remain looking good over time.

What Materials Offer the Best Water Resistance and Durability?

The materials that offer the best water resistance and durability for men’s casual rain boots include:

  • Rubber: Rubber is a classic choice for rain boots due to its natural waterproof properties. It is highly durable, resistant to wear and tear, and can withstand various weather conditions, making it ideal for wet environments.
  • Nylon: Nylon is often used in combination with rubber for added flexibility and comfort. It is water-resistant and lightweight, allowing for breathability while still providing protection against rain and mud.
  • GORE-TEX: GORE-TEX is a high-performance waterproof material that is both breathable and durable. This technology allows moisture from the inside to escape while preventing water from entering, making it perfect for extended wear in wet conditions.
  • Neoprene: Neoprene is a synthetic rubber that offers excellent insulation and water resistance. It is flexible and comfortable, providing a snug fit that helps to keep feet warm and dry during rainy weather.
  • Polyurethane (PU): Polyurethane is a synthetic material known for its water resistance and durability. It is often used in rain boots for its lightweight nature and ability to withstand harsh conditions without cracking or degrading over time.

What Styles of Men’s Casual Rain Boots Are Trending?

The trending styles of men’s casual rain boots combine functionality with modern aesthetics, ensuring both comfort and style in wet weather.

  • Chukka Rain Boots: These ankle-high boots offer a stylish silhouette that pairs well with both casual and semi-formal outfits. Typically made from waterproof materials, they feature a lace-up design that adds a touch of sophistication while maintaining a relaxed vibe.
  • Rubber Chelsea Boots: Known for their sleek, slip-on design, rubber Chelsea boots are perfect for those looking for convenience and style. They are made from durable rubber, ensuring they keep feet dry while their elastic side panels provide ease in putting them on and taking them off.
  • Duck Boots: A classic choice, duck boots are characterized by their waterproof lower section and stylish leather upper. They are designed for functionality, providing excellent traction and insulation, making them ideal for both muddy and rainy conditions.
  • Mid-Calf Rain Boots: These boots extend higher up the leg, offering extra protection from water and mud. Often featuring fun patterns or bright colors, they can make a bold statement while keeping the wearer dry and comfortable during downpours.
  • Fashion Sneakers with Waterproof Features: Blending the comfort of sneakers with waterproof materials, these boots are perfect for casual outings. They often come with stylish designs and colorways, making them versatile enough for everyday wear while still providing protection against the rain.

How Should You Choose the Right Size for Men’s Casual Rain Boots?

Choosing the right size for men’s casual rain boots involves several important factors:

  • Measure Your Feet: Accurate foot measurement is essential; measure both length and width to ensure a proper fit.
  • Consider Sock Thickness: The type of socks you’ll wear with the boots can affect sizing, so account for thicker socks if you’re planning to wear them.
  • Fit Preferences: Some may prefer a snug fit for stability, while others might opt for a looser fit for comfort, which can influence your size choice.
  • Brand Sizing Variations: Different brands may have different sizing charts, so consult the specific brand’s size guide before making a purchase.
  • Try Before You Buy: When possible, trying on the boots in-store can help you assess comfort and fit, ensuring you make the best choice for your feet.

Accurate foot measurement not only encompasses the length but also the width to account for different foot shapes, which can help in selecting boots that won’t pinch or cause discomfort during wear.

When considering sock thickness, it’s important to remember that thicker socks can take up more space inside the boot, potentially leading to a tighter fit if the size is not adjusted accordingly.

Your fit preferences play a crucial role; if you enjoy a snug fit for activities like hiking or walking, you might choose a size that is closer to your exact measurements, while those looking for all-day comfort may prefer a size with a bit more room.

Since sizing can vary significantly between brands, it’s advisable to check the size chart of the specific brand you’re interested in, as this can ensure you select the best fit for their unique sizing standards.

Trying on the boots in-store allows you to walk around and assess how they feel, which is invaluable in determining the right size and avoiding the hassle of returns later.

How Do Men’s Casual Rain Boots Perform in Various Weather Conditions?

Men’s casual rain boots are designed to perform effectively in various weather conditions, offering both functionality and style.

  • Waterproof Materials: Many casual rain boots are constructed from waterproof materials such as rubber or synthetic fabrics. These materials prevent water from seeping in, ensuring that your feet stay dry even in heavy rain.
  • Non-slip Soles: The best men’s casual rain boots feature non-slip soles that provide traction on wet surfaces. This is crucial for maintaining stability and preventing slips and falls when walking on slick pavements or muddy terrain.
  • Insulation: Some models come with added insulation to keep feet warm in colder, rainy conditions. This is particularly beneficial in transitional seasons where temperatures can fluctuate, making it essential to have boots that can adapt.
  • Breathability: Despite being waterproof, many casual rain boots are designed with breathable linings. This feature allows moisture from perspiration to escape, keeping feet comfortable during extended wear in varying weather conditions.
  • Style Versatility: Casual rain boots are often designed with aesthetics in mind, allowing them to be worn in both casual and semi-formal settings. This versatility makes them suitable for a range of activities, from outdoor adventures to urban outings.
  • Easy Maintenance: Most men’s casual rain boots are easy to clean and maintain, which is essential for longevity. A simple wipe-down with a damp cloth is often sufficient to remove mud and dirt, keeping the boots looking fresh.
